Holmwood is an absolutely gorgeous 16th Century Romantic Thatched Cottage, with beautiful interiors and high quality furnishing.
It is in a group of 5 cottages and a pub next to the Sudbury to Ipswich Main Road, located in a very pretty part of Suffolk close to Kersey which is Suffolk prettiest hamlet, Boxford which is a gem of a tiny village and Polsted which is where the best walks are to be found.
This self catering cottage is so pretty with its lovely thatched roof and mature cottage garden, there is an old tree offering some summer shade for when you want to use the garden table there. In the courtyard there is a big breakfast table with wisteria tumbling down the soft red brick walls and old wood stables that surround you on 3 sides capturing the sun and giving privacy and protection on windier days.
There is a BBQ patio at the back and a pretty garden pond fed from the natural spring. Please note that this garden is enclosed but not dog proof and small children should be supervised when in the garden even though the pond is fenced.
You enter the cottage by the Kitchen: which is all hand made by a master craftsman as are all the wonderful restorations and discrete modern conveniences throughout this historic 16th Century cottage. Cooking is done on a large electric range and the kitchen has the added luxury of a dishwasher.
The dining table easily sits 6 in this cosy farmhouse style kitchen with its
original Suffolk White brick floor and high arched ceiling.
A lovely old door leads out to the BBQ patio and another to the the hall where the downstairs bathroom is located, this has a separate bath and shower fitted and is a very well designed.
Off the hall is the large main room with its lovely inglenook fireplace which for fire safety reasons now has an electric 'flame effect' wood burner. There are 2 big comfy sofas and a big armchair easily arranged around an interesting Kelim covered coffee table which is great for putting your feet up on, the old winding staircase off the main room leads you up to a pretty double bedroom and through this to a twin bedroom separated by a door.
Guests who are less than able should not book this cottage because the staircase is tight and steep and absolutely listed - for those who can manage it, it is just another wonderful feature of this beautiful cottage.
Throughout the cottage the renovation has been very carefully carried out so that proper lathe and plaster walls with all their character and imperfections have been reinstated, beautiful worn brick floors have been carefully repaired, ancient beams exposed and cherished, original doors, windows and frames bought back to life and the whole atmosphere of the original building authentically reinstated.
